Interface GigyaB2BWebhookFacade

All Known Implementing Classes:
DefaultGigyaB2BWebhookFacade

public interface GigyaB2BWebhookFacade
Facade to carry out gigya login functionality
  • Method Details

    • receiveGigyaWebHookEvents

      void receiveGigyaWebHookEvents(GigyaWebHookRequest webhookRequest)
      Receives the CDC Webhook events and schedules a task to create / update B2B users
      Parameters:
      webhookRequest - The incoming CDC Webhook Request
    • validateWebHookJWTToken

      boolean validateWebHookJWTToken(String jwtToken, String baseSiteId, String payloadHash)
      Validate the JWT Token for CDC WebHook
      Parameters:
      jwtToken - JWT Token
      baseSiteId - Base site identifier
      payloadHash - Payload Hash String
      Returns:
      boolean, true if the JWT is valid